2020 Shelby GT500 Mustang: The Legend Returns

Ford today unveiled the long-anticipated 2020 Shelby GT500 Mustang. The pinnacle of Mustang performance will have a hand-built supercharged 5.2-liter V8 engine producing more than 700 horsepower. The new Mustang utilizes a dual-clutch 7-speed transmission capable of shifts in less… Read more ›

Cadillac XT6 Three-Row Crossover Unveiled to Tepid Response

General Motors has unveiled the 2020 Cadillac XT6, its first three-row crossover which sits above the two-row XT5 and below the Escalade. The XT6 is built off the C1XX platform which also underpins Chevy Traverse, GMC Acadia and Buick Enclave… Read more ›

2020 Toyota Supra Leaks Ahead of NAIAS Reveal

The new 2020 Toyota Supra, jointly developed with BMW and featuring a turbocharged BMW inline 6 made an unscheduled debut online today. Further details will follow on Monday.
